Mr Chance has worked in the fields of commercial management, production planning, market research and quality control. Since moving to South Africa from England, Mr Chance has developed expertise in the ICT and communications industries including journalism, book and online publishing, computer-based training and education, corporate video and multimedia production, e-commerce systems development, PR and events management. In 1994 he was named Mr Multimedia by a leading computer magazine and became a sought-after speaker as well as TV and radio guest on technology talk shows. In July 1998 he and a partner founded Mondo Interactive Media to focus on the growing field of eCommerce. In April 2005 Mr Chance was appointed Business Development Director at Adele Lucas Promotions (ALP), a leading events management and communications company.
Mr Chance was elected a Member of Parliament after the May 2014 elections, representing the Democratic Alliance as Shadow Minister of Small Business Development
